Their size, structure, and flexibility make them an ideal solution for. . How much energy can a 20-foot energy storage box store? A 20-foot energy storage box can typically store approximately 1,500 to 2,000 kWh of energy, depending on the technology utilized, the type of battery system integrated, and the design specifications of the container. The energy storage battery system adopts 1500V non-walk-in container design, and the box integrates energy storage battery clusters, DC convergence cabinets, AC power distribution cabinets, temperature control system, automatic fire-fighting system, lighting system and so on.
